Cyber fraudsters running “online task” rackets are increasingly targeting citizens’ bank accounts. In a shocking incident, one such scam allegedly pushed a 17-year-old youth to suicide after he was misled and financially trapped by the fraudsters.

The deceased boy, a resident of Meghwadi in Mumbai's Jogeshwari area, was a Class XII student. Nearly 11 months after his death, the Andheri Railway Police have finally registered an FIR against eight accused involved in the online scam.
